Three narrow edits land the D-3 pattern (context.WithoutCancel for
subsidiary async writes and deferred shutdown contexts):

  - internal/api/middleware/audit.go  -- async audit goroutine now runs
    on auditCtx := context.WithoutCancel(r.Context()) instead of
    context.Background(). Preserves request-scoped values (trace ID, auth)
    while detaching from the request's cancellation so the audit write
    does not get killed when the response completes. Goroutine is still
    tracked via a.wg (M-1 shutdown drain) so Flush(ctx) behaviour is
    unchanged. CWE-770 Missing Release (goroutine leak potential) +
    CWE-400 Resource Exhaustion (missed cancellation propagation).

  - internal/api/middleware/middleware.go -- Recovery panic path now
    logs via slog.ErrorContext(ctx, ...) instead of log.Printf. Request-
    scoped trace/auth metadata now carries through the panic log, matching
    every other request log. D-3 non-bypass: the context is r.Context()
    captured before the defer, so even a panic mid-handler propagates
    the ctx's trace ID into the ERROR log line.

  - internal/connector/issuer/acme/acme.go (HTTP-01 challenge server
    shutdown) -- defer shutdown context derived from
    context.WithTimeout(context.WithoutCancel(ctx), 5s) instead of
    context.Background(). Preserves parent ctx values, detaches from
    parent cancellation so Shutdown always gets its full 5-second
    budget even when the parent was cancelled. Matches the same pattern
    applied in ACME's solveAuthorizationsDNS01 and solveAuthorizationsDNSPersist01.

Linter wiring: .golangci.yml adds `contextcheck` to the enabled set.
golangci-lint v2.11.4 now fails CI on any function that takes a
context.Context parameter but calls into context.Background() or
context.TODO() instead of propagating -- regression guard for all five
prior PRs.

// Derive a detached context that preserves request-scoped values
// (trace IDs, auth info carried via context keys) but is not cancelled
// when the HTTP server finalizes the request. Using r.Context()
// directly would cause the async audit write to observe ctx.Done()
// as soon as the response completes; using context.Background() would
// discard useful observability metadata. WithoutCancel gives us both
// (M-2 / D-3).
auditCtx := context.WithoutCancel(r.Context())
